Soliant is seeking a qualified and dedicated School Psychologist for a full-time position for the upcoming 2026-2027 school year. This role focuses on supporting students' academic achievement, social-emotional development, and behavioral success through assessment, intervention, and collaboration with school teams.
Responsibilities:
Conduct comprehensive psychological evaluations and assessments Interpret results and develop detailed, compliant reports Participate in IEP and eligibility meetings Provide recommendations for academic, behavioral, and social-emotional interventions Collaborate with teachers, parents, and multidisciplinary teams Support crisis intervention and behavioral management as needed Maintain accurate documentation in accordance with state and federal guidelines
Qualifications:
Master's or Doctoral degree in School Psychology Active state licensure or certification as a School Psychologist Previous school-based experience preferred Strong knowledge of special education processes and timelines Excellent communication, organization, and collaboration skills
